Changed look at Old School House

The erstwhile three-story Griswold’s Hotel is finally coming down.

Pieces of the long-vacant building are slowly being taken apart by construction crews, in a relatively small space just north of the Buca di Beppo parking lot. The entire roof and most of the top floor is gone, and pieces of wood are piled up at the foot of the building to be collected for recycling.

According to construction crews at the scene, the heavy duty work is expected to begin in the next week.

The portion of the hotel is being demolished to make room for a 30-unit condominium building and a 240-space parking garage, which will become the newest addition to the Old School House center, according to the city.

In July 2107, plans were approved by the city council, 11 years after the specific plan was approved in 2006 and after multiple changes to the design.

The three-story residential building will be placed at the current site of the parking lot directly north of the hotel. The parking garage, part of which will go underground, will replace the hotel’s footprint.

The plan also calls for a new private road, to be built along the north end of the new condo building and extended behind Candlelight Pavilion to Indian Hill Boulevard.
